import debug from "debug";
import express from "express";
import http from "http";
import socketIO from "socket.io";
const serverDebug = debug("server");
const ioDebug = debug("io");
const socketDebug = debug("socket");
const app = express();
app.use(express.static("public"));
const port = process.env.PORT || 80; // default port to listen
app.use(express.static("public"));
app.get("/", (req, res) => {
res.send("Excalidraw collaboration server is up :)");
});
const server = http.createServer(app);
server.listen(port, () => {
serverDebug(`listening on port: ${port}`);
});
const io = socketIO(server, {
handlePreflightRequest: function (req, res) {
const headers = {
"Access-Control-Allow-Headers": "Content-Type, Authorization",
"Access-Control-Allow-Origin":
(req.header && req.header.origin) || "https://excalidraw.com",
"Access-Control-Allow-Credentials": true,
};
res.writeHead(200, headers);
res.end();
},
});
io.on("connection", (socket) => {
ioDebug("connection established!");
io.to(`${socket.id}`).emit("init-room");
socket.on("join-room", (roomID) => {
socketDebug(`${socket.id} has joined ${roomID}`);
socket.join(roomID);
if (io.sockets.adapter.rooms[roomID].length <= 1) {
io.to(`${socket.id}`).emit("first-in-room");
} else {
socket.broadcast.to(roomID).emit("new-user", socket.id);
}
io.in(roomID).emit(
"room-user-change",
Object.keys(io.sockets.adapter.rooms[roomID].sockets)
);
});
socket.on(
"server-broadcast",
(roomID: string, encryptedData: ArrayBuffer, iv: Uint8Array) => {
socketDebug(`${socket.id} sends update to ${roomID}`);
socket.broadcast.to(roomID).emit("client-broadcast", encryptedData, iv);
}
);
socket.on(
"server-volatile-broadcast",
(roomID: string, encryptedData: ArrayBuffer, iv: Uint8Array) => {
socketDebug(`${socket.id} sends volatile update to ${roomID}`);
socket.volatile.broadcast
.to(roomID)
.emit("client-broadcast", encryptedData, iv);
}
);
socket.on("disconnecting", () => {
const rooms = io.sockets.adapter.rooms;
for (const roomID in socket.rooms) {
const clients = Object.keys(rooms[roomID].sockets).filter(
(id) => id !== socket.id
);
if (clients.length > 0) {
socket.broadcast.to(roomID).emit("room-user-change", clients);
}
}
});
socket.on("disconnect", () => {
socket.removeAllListeners();
});
});
